    Cinnamon-Graham Crackers


    Source of Recipe


    Better Homes and Garden Heritage Cookbook, 1975

    List of Ingredients




    2 c Whole wheat flour
    1 c All-purpose flour
    1 ts Baking powder
    1/2 ts Baking soda
    3/4 c Packed brown sugar
    1/2 c Shortening
    1/3 c Honey
    1 ts Vanilla
    1/2 c Milk
    3 T Granulated sugar
    1 ts Ground cinnamon

    Recipe



    Stir together whole wheat flour, all
    purpose flour, baking powder, baking
    soda, and salt.

    Cream together brown sugar and
    shortening till light.

    Beat in honey and vanbilla till fluffy.

    Add flour mixture alternately with milk
    to creamed mixture, beating well after
    each addition.

    Chill dough several hours or overnight.

    Divide chilled mixture into quarters.

    On well-floured surface, roll each
    quarter to 15x5-inch rectangle.

    Cut rectangle crosswise into 6 small
    rectangles measuring 5x2 1/2 inches.

    Place on ungreased baking sheet.

    Mark a line crosswise across center
    of each small rectangle with tines
    of fork; score a pattern of holes
    on squares with fork tines.

    Combine granulated sugar and cinnamon;
    Sprinkle over crackers.

    Bake at 350 F for 13-15 minutes.

    Remove from sheet at once.
